The first step in submitting mesothelioma claims is to collect medical records that show mesothelioma as a diagnosis. A mesothelioma lawyer will help locate these records and obtain them from the medical facilities.

Mesothelioma patients typically undergo various tests to diagnose their condition and determine the most effective course of treatment. These tests include chest CT scan, MRI, PET or ultrasound as well as a biopsy. In a biopsy, doctors remove a small sample of tissue to test for mesothelioma. Patients typically experience intense pain. The biopsy procedure can be done using VATS (video-assisted surgical thoracoscopic procedure), keyhole surgery, or a CT-guided needle biopsy.

Damages

A mesothelioma lawyer can assist the victim or their family to file a lawsuit against asbestos-related companies. Compensation in a mesothelioma lawsuit can help victims pay for expenses for treatment and replace income loss, as well as give their families financial stability. Compensation may also include additional damages for emotional trauma or pain and suffering and much more.

A top mesothelioma law firm can analyze a client's specific circumstances and determine which kind of claim to bring. Mesothelioma claims usually fall into one of three categories which include personal injury lawsuits or grievous death claim, or a trust fund claim.

Personal injury lawsuits are founded on the theory of an immediate link between an asbestos-related disease or injury and the negligence of the defendant. A lawyer who has handled many mesothelioma cases can demonstrate this connection by utilizing medical evidence, witness testimony, and other legal resources.

In wrongful death lawsuits, the plaintiff seeks compensation for the estates of mesothelioma patients, typically their spouses or children. Similar to a personal injury claim, a wrongful death lawsuit may be filed against a variety of parties and resolved by a settlement or trial verdict.
